Output 63e2e726333f0442c67b9d6f6ee8ae865ece37f2e59ca6681abd16fef9143530:33

value
25990
script pubkey
OP_HASH160 OP_PUSHBYTES_20 481f2419b85f103fc92843edf9df35da4c447c6d OP_EQUAL
address
38GMt56LiY1iaJ8u9hxsyQSsUR6p25EguH
transaction
63e2e726333f0442c67b9d6f6ee8ae865ece37f2e59ca6681abd16fef9143530
confirmations
229478
spent
true